@патрикса в Mac AppStore и от установленных разработчиков. Я попытался установить его в любом месте, но до сих пор не могу запустить Xcode :( К сожалению, я не могу вернуться и проверить это. Я уверен, что ваша идея правильная. да, точно :( Да, я знаю об этом - на самом деле я кросс-компиляции своих пакетов, но они не больше, чем пользователей приложений (например, CRM-системы, различные "станции" и т. д.) Извините, я перепутал. Как бы отжимания не повредить ваши яички? Выглядит интересно, спасибо. _Technically_ ваш ответ заслуживает отметку, хотя более полный может украсть его :-Р Это может быть, что после того, как дополнительный материал включен, то советник считает, что его вклад приравнивается к роли консультанта, а не соавтора.

У меня Intel 750-диск новейшая. Работает отлично. Ну.. вроде. Я хотел бы использовать это устройство в качестве корневой файловой системы.

У меня нет поддержки пользователя для устройства NVMe.

  1. У меня встроенный драйвер включен в ядро, а не модулем. Я могу смонтировать устройство nmve. Я скопировал корневой файловой системы для его.

Когда я пытаюсь использовать это устройство в качестве корневой файловой системы в файл grub2 я получаю неизвестное устройство.

Это линия для grub2 для ядра и параметров:

Линукс ядра-4.1.6-субантарктический корень=/Дев/nvme0n1p1 РО тихий

почему это? Драйвер в ядре. Его не модуль. Ей ничего не нужно от корня файловой системы. Это через BIOS для доступа к /dev/nvme0n1p1?

  1. Моя вторая попытка была использовать пакет initramfs. Я использовал процесс, чтобы создать в initramfs.

    В этом тоже есть проблема с /dev/nvme0n1p1. Он загружается в Linux, используя в initramfs. Но, когда он пытается установить реальную корневую файловую систему через сценарий системе это не удается, на проверку блока устройства

.... Проверьте блок устройств или /dev/НФС Элиф [ -б "${REAL_ROOT}" ] || [ "${REAL_ROOT}" = "в/dev/НФС" ] ...

REAL_ROOT находится на dev/nvme0n1p1 (я добавил некоторые отладки кода)

Я взломал этот сценарий, чтобы просто смонтировать /dev/nvme0n1p1 а также терпит неудачу. Его не существует.

Странная вещь... после того, как не он предлагает пользователю ввести корневую файловую систему и... Я ввожу "/Дев/nvme0n1p1" и она отлично работает. Сапоги.

Кроме того, это позволит ввести снаряд.. и /dev/nvme0n1p1 есть... и тест

Элиф [ -б "${REAL_ROOT}" ]

проходит в оболочке.

Итак, что происходит в #1. Должна ли такая работа? Это в BIOS используется (что бы провалился, потому что мой BIOS не поддержка NVMe)?

#2 это очень странно и выглядит как ошибка для меня. Это, как говорится... как можно кто-нибудь использовать встроенный в корень устройства, потом. Я уверен, что Google будет возвращается что-то из моего поиска.